Answered from the vendors’ own pages
Duck Creek Policy: How much does Duck Creek Policy cost?
Duck Creek does not publish pricing. Policy is an enterprise solution for insurance carriers where implementation scope, data migration complexity, and customization requirements determine total cost of ownership. Interested prospects must contact Duck Creek's sales team through their 'Talk to Sales' call-to-action.
SourceSentinelOne: What is SentinelOne Singularity Complete pricing?
Singularity Complete costs $179.99 per endpoint per year and includes AI-driven endpoint and cloud workload protection, real-time threat detection and response, 14-day data retention, and AI Security Assistant. Pricing shown for 5-100 workstations.
SourceDuck Creek Policy: Is Duck Creek Policy a modular system?
Yes, customers can adopt Duck Creek products individually (Policy, Rating, Billing, Claims, etc.) or in combination. This modularity means pricing varies based on which products and integration depth customers require.
SourceSentinelOne: What features distinguish SentinelOne Commercial from Complete?
Singularity Commercial costs $229.99 per endpoint per year (versus $179.99 for Complete) and adds Identity Detection and Response, 90-day data retention (compared to 14-day), and Managed Threat Hunting services.
SourceSentinelOne: How does partner pricing affect SentinelOne costs?
All SentinelOne purchases are made through authorized third-party partners, and partner pricing may differ from published rates. Customers should verify pricing with their authorized reseller.
SourceSentinelOne: What does SentinelOne Enterprise include?
Singularity Enterprise (custom pricing, contact sales) adds Agentic AI SOC Analyst and Full Visibility and Forensics capabilities to all Commercial features, plus expert-led onboarding and training.
